announced it has redesigned its Web site with additional functionality and made it easier for insurance producers to use.
New features and design improvements include changing the sign-in
identification from producer code to e-mail address. An improved and
expanded edit profile feature can now be used to easily update account information. An internal search feature leveraging the familiar Google search engine was added.
The site programming was updated for improved navigation throughout the entire site while signed in. A Forms Download XML Web Service is provided for producers with intranets in their offices, enabling a producer to access Anderson Murison’s most current forms without
the producer even having to go to the Web site.
Ongoing services include enabling producers to look-up their open accounting information and policy status information for business with Anderson Murison, as well as, self rate several of Anderson Murison’s most popular programs including personal umbrella and dwelling/homeowners.
